Instructions

Video
  1. To make the sauce: Combine the sauce mayonnaise, Creole mustard, horseradish, hot sauce, lemon juice, smoked paprika, grated garlic, green onion, and minced capers in a bowl.
  2. Whisk until completely emulsified.
  3. Set remoulade sauce aside.
  4. Heat a large griddle or skillet over medium heat.
  5. Spread a thin, even layer of mayonnaise on the outside faces of each slice of Shokupan.
  6. Toast the bread on the griddle on both sides, until deeply golden brown and crisp. Remove from heat.
  7. Spread exactly 1 Tbsp of the remoulade sauce onto the inside face of the bottom slice, and another 1 Tbsp onto the top slice.
  8. Lay down two leaves of Romaine lettuce on the bottom slice of bread.
  9. Layer 2 to 3 slices of the cold meatloaf over the lettuce.
  10. Place one slice of sharp cheddar cheese directly onto the meatloaf.
  11. Top the cheese with three slices of tomato.
  12. Close the sandwich with the top slice of toasted bread and cut diagonally.

Note

Mayo browns more evenly than butter and doesn't burn as quickly. It creates a completely uniform, crispy crust on the Shokupan.
Build the lettuce under the meat. It acts as a moisture barrier so the bottom bread stays crisp.
Cold meatloaf holds its structural shape best when sliced directly out of the refrigerator.
